Benet practises in all areas of Intellectual Property law as well as contractual and commercial disputes, particularly those with a technical or entertainment law aspect.

He has a particular interest in Trade Mark law and has appeared in a number of significant recent trade mark cases including Cartier v BSkyB and others, which established the availability and conditions for the grant of Internet blocking injunctions in areas other than copyright, Merck v Merck, which considered the law on targeting, use in the course of trade and scope of revocation for non-use of trade mark. He also appears regularly in the General Court and Court of Justice of the European Union including OHIM v National Lottery Commission Case C-530/12P, which established the obligation on EUIPO to investigate matters of law in trade mark invalidation actions, and Brandconcern v EUIPO Case C-577/14 P, which established the proper approach to class heading specifications.

Prior to taking Silk, Benet was appointed to the Attorney-General’s A panel of Counsel in 2015, whose members deal with the most complex government cases in all kinds of courts and tribunals, often against QCs. From 2005 – 2010 Benet was on the C panel, advising on disputes ranging from claims for breach of contract arising out of the UK-Russia Closed Nuclear Cities Partnership to claims for infringement of data protection principles by prisoners.

Benet Brandreth KC is an efficient, pragmatic and responsive silk recommended for his commercial advice. He enjoys a strong reputation for trade mark and copyright infringement disputes and has recently been active in licensing disputes involving life sciences companies. He also has experience in litigation concerning mechanical patents. He has acted in appellate trade mark-related proceedings in the Supreme Court and in Luxembourg.
